, military exercises, rigorous physical training, and fear of authority. These factors are meant to transform a troubled teen into a “good soldier” following the rules. Another important aspect which has to be taken into consideration is being represented by the fact that most wilderness programs including boot camps are not addressing underlying emotional or behavioral problems. Also, it is important to be considered the fact that long-term effectiveness is limited without therapy or behavior modification.
The best chance for long-term is to follow it with a treatment program, in case parents choose to send their troubled teens to wilderness programs such as boot camps. Making part of wilderness programs, wilderness camps are considered to be a quite good alternative to boot camps, because of the fact that instead of the aggressive approach which boot camps tend to use, wilderness programs focus on behavior modification programs with a component of the program held outdoors. Urban distractions are being removed in order to make it easier for troubled teens to reconnect and to accept responsibility for their choices.

The national institute on drug abuse characterize substance abuse as, "as a chronic, relapsing brain disease that is characterized by compulsive drug seeking and use, despite harmful consequences. It is considered a brain disease because drugs change the brain; they change its structure and how it works. These brain changes can be long lasting and can lead to many harmful, often self-destructive, behaviors.'
